Sure, you are probably aware that this piece of equipment is used to provide imaging of fetuses in the womb, and that it is an invaluable tool for assisting in providing quality medical care to pregnant women. That’s not all they are used for, however. Actually, the ultrasound serves many functions, and is used by doctors to provide diagnoses for a variety of diseases and afflictions. It is really a very versatile tool, arguably even more so than something like the X-ray or the MRI.
